    Jerome Historic Home Tour Presents
    Virtual Version this year

    May 7, 2020No Comments
    Facebook Twitter Pinterest LinkedIn Email Reddit WhatsApp
    Share
    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email Reddit WhatsApp

    Jrome Chamber of CommerceJerome AZ (May 7, 2020) – For the first time in 55 years, Jerome will not be having The Annual Historic Home and Building Tour due to the Covid-19 Pandemic. This is the longest running home tour in the state of Arizona, and draws approximately 1500 people in two days for the wonderful celebration of historic and unique homes in the mile-high town. This tour is the major fundraiser for the Jerome Chamber of Commerce.

    The weekend requires homeowners to open their homes plus the help of 70 volunteers to accomplish the exciting event. Enjoy this look back at some great homes from the past tours.
